2017 delivered excellent spring rains and occasional summer rainfall. The harvest was plentiful with delayed ripening. Despite the rain, the vines remained healthy with little pressure from pests and disease.

2016 was a very dry year resulting in low yielding wines and small berry sizes. These were ideal conditions for making a dessert wine from concentrated fruit.

2015 was a great year. There were good spring rains. The summer was mostly dry, however a few short rain events maintained soil moisture until harvest. Favourable weather conditions meant that minimal fungicide treatment was required on the vines. Yields were good and there was little pressure from pests and diseases.

2014 was a relatively dry year with a hot summer. A few short rain events maintained soil moisture until harvest. Minimal fungicide treatment was required on the vines. Yields were good and there was little pressure from pests and diseases. Ripening of the grapes occurred rapidly in the weather conditions.
